👨‍🍳 Keto Chocolate Bars Ingredients

To make the keto friendly chocolate bars you will need:

  • 9oz (250g) Low Carb Chocolate Chips
  • 1 1/2 cups Nuts (Walnuts / Pecans / Peanuts)
  • 1/2 cup Peanut Butter

⭐ Making Low Carb Chocolate Bars

Make the best keto chocolate bars! Follow this recipe:

Step 1

Start by lining a 8 or 9 inch pan with parchment paper. Then, chop the nuts.

Step 2

Melt the chocolate (make sure not to burn it. You can use the microwave and do it in 20-second intervals), and then mix all the ingredients.

Step 3

Pour the mixture into the pan and spread evenly. Place in the freezer for about 15 minutes. Then, slice them and serve.

Peanut Butter

To make these keto chocolate bars so delicious, I used peanut butter, which gives them a great flavor and texture.

If you don’t have peanut butter, you can substitute almond butter or any other nut butter of your choice.

You can even mix different nut butters together to create a unique flavor.

Nuts

You can use any type of nut for these low carb chocolate bars. To make a low-carb version, you’ll want to use nuts that are low in carbs such as almonds or pecans.

I prefer to chop the nuts before adding them, but you can also leave them whole.

Low Carb Chocolate Chips

These keto friendly chocolate bars are made using low carb chocolate chips.

I used Lily’s brand chocolate chips which are sweetened with stevia, making them sugar free and perfect for a low carb diet.

But of course, you can use any sugar free chocolate chips you prefer. You can also just use plain dark chocolate chips, but obviously they won’t be as sweet.

Storage

You can freeze them, and they will last up to 3 months in the freezer. The texture won’t change, so you can enjoy them as if they were fresh.
